The Taj Mahal from Persian and Arabic, "crown of royal residences", professed is a white marble catacomb situated on the southern bank of Yamuna River in the Indian city of Agra. It was dispatched in 1632 by the Mughal sovereign Shah Jahan (ruled 1628–1658) to house the tomb of his most loved wife of three, Mumtaz Mahal.
Development of the catacomb was basically finished in 1643 yet work proceeded on different periods of the venture for an extra ten years. The Taj Mahal complex is accepted to have been finished in its whole in 1653 at an expense evaluated at the time to be around 32 million Indian rupees, which in 2015 future esteemed at around 52.8 billion Indian rupees ($827 million US). The development task utilized around 20,000 artisans under the direction of a leading body of engineers drove by Ustad Ahmad Lahauri. The domed marble tomb is a piece of an incorporated complex comprising of greenery enclosures and two red-sandstone structures encompassed by a crenelated divider on three sides.
The Taj Mahal is viewed by numerous as the best case of Mughal structural engineering and is broadly perceived as "the gem of Muslim craftsmanship in India".
